Что такое CDN и зачем требуются системы передачи материалов
CDN является собой географически распределённую инфраструктуру для скоростной распространения веб-контента юзерам. Сеть включает из серверов, расположенных в разных местах мира. Основная задача CDN заключается в сокращении времени подгрузки веб-страниц, изображений и видеофайлов. Методика отправляет сведения с ближайшего географического сервера, минимизируя расстояние между гаджетом pin up пользователя и сервером информации.
Проблема производительности открытия порталов
Скорость открытия веб-ресурсов сказывается на пользовательский восприятие и торговые индикаторы бизнеса. Медленная передача контента увеличивает показатель отказов и снижает результативность. Посетители ждут моментальной подгрузки страниц пин ап, пауза в несколько секунд провоцирует неблагоприятную реакцию.
Пространственное промежуток между сервером и пользователем создаёт естественные препятствия отправки информации. Вызов от клиента из Азии к серверу в Европе покрывает тысячи километров, наращивая задержку. Каждый маршрутизатор на маршруте следования пакетов привносит миллисекунды задержки.
Серьёзная нагруженность на одиночный машину замедляет обработку обращений всех посетителей. Наивысшие моменты формируют последовательности вызовов, которые машина не справляется выполнять. Недостаточная пропускная способность линии оказывается критичным участком при транспортировке мультимедийного содержимого.
Современные веб-страницы включают обилие компонентов: фотографии, видеоролики, скрипты и таблицы стилей. Совокупный объём подгружаемых документов pin up составляет нескольких мегабайт. Переносные гаджеты восприимчивы к трудностям скорости из-за нестабильности беспроводных сетей.
Как действует сеть распространения содержимого
Система распространения контента работает по механизму территориального распределения копий сведений между машинами. Поставщик CDN размещает точки присутствия в разных областях, формируя всемирную систему. Когда юзер вызывает веб-страницу, система определяет близлежащий к нему сервер.
DNS-маршрутизация перенаправляет вызов к наилучшему пункту на основе территориального местонахождения клиента. Алгоритмы оценивают загруженность узлов, наличие каналов и качество соединения. Платформа выбирает узел с наименьшим периодом реакции.
Периферийный узел проверяет существование требуемого файла в локальном кэше. Если копия присутствует и актуальна, узел передаёт информацию пользователю. Отсутствие данных пин ап казино вызывает вызов к первоисточнику для извлечения исходника.
Извлечённый материал сохраняется на периферийном пункте для последующих запросов. Следующие посетители из региона получают данные из регионального кэша без запроса к основному машине. Система дублирования синхронизирует материал между точками присутствия. Обновление данных вызывает удаление старых реплик в рассредоточенной сети.
Ключевые компоненты CDN-инфраструктуры
Инфраструктура сети распространения контента состоит из взаимосвязанных технологических составляющих. Каждый компонент выполняет особые функции пин ап в течении отправки информации клиентам.
- Периферийные узлы размещены пространственно близко к финальным пользователям. Узлы сберегают кэшированные копии содержимого и выполняют поступающие запросы. Размещение узлов по континентам уменьшает реальное промежуток транспортировки информации.
- Исходный сервер включает оригинальные копии всех файлов веб-ресурса. Краевые пункты обращаются к источнику при отсутствии материалов в локальном кэше. Основное хранилище обеспечивает актуальность данных в рассредоточенной сети.
- Платформа администрирования материалами согласует функционирование всех узлов системы. Платформа отслеживает статус серверов, рассредоточивает нагрузку и регулирует записью. Административная панель обеспечивает устанавливать правила обработки данных.
- Балансировщики нагрузки рассредоточивают поступающий трафик между активными машинами. Устройства исследуют загруженность узлов и перенаправляют обращения к менее разгруженным машинам. Процесс блокирует переполнение при стремительном росте активности.
Запись документов на распределенных узлах
Кэширование является собой размещение копий документов на пространственно рассредоточенных серверах. Система обеспечивает хранить постоянный содержимое ближе к клиентам, снижая время передачи. Периферийные узлы формируют локальные копии фотографий, видео, таблиц стилей и скриптов.
Методы сохранения определяют правила размещения разных категорий материалов. Статические файлы записываются на длительный промежуток, поскольку изредка модифицируются. Изменяемый контент предполагает постоянного модификации или исключения из кэша. Конфигурации периода актуальности сказываются на соотношение между свежестью и быстродействием отправки.
Процесс инвалидации стирает старые версии данных из распределённого репозитория. При обновлении контента пин ап казино платформа отправляет уведомления периферийным узлам о нужде модификации. Процесс удаления гарантирует выравнивание сведений между узлами присутствия.
Заголовки HTTP контролируют работой записи на разнообразных ступенях структуры. Инструкции Cache-Control определяют принципы записи и актуализации данных. Параметры ETag позволяют проверять современность контента без полноценной подгрузки. Выборочные запросы сокращают транспортировку информации при недостатке правок.
Как CDN уменьшает загрузку на центральный сервер
Рассредоточение запросов между пограничными серверами освобождает центральный сервер от выполнения повторяющихся обращений. Основная масса вызовов к статическому контенту выполняются местными пунктами без участия исходного узла. Главная система обрабатывает исключительно индивидуальные обращения и изменяемый контент.
Запись статических материалов исключает потребность неоднократной передачи идентичных файлов. Фотографии, ролики и таблицы стилей загружаются с исходного сервера однократно, затем обслуживаются из кэша. Сокращение запросов к основному серверу высвобождает процессорные возможности для трудных процессов.
Пропускная мощность соединения исходного машины расходуется рациональнее при использовании CDN. Передача мультимедийного контента выполняется через рассредоточенную структуру серверов. Исходный сервер отправляет данные лишь на точки присутствия, а не каждому пользователю.
Территориальное распределение загрузки блокирует перегрузку главного узла в промежутки высокой трафика. Пиковые нагруженности распределяются между узлами в разнообразных зонах. Надёжность системы pin up возрастает благодаря дублированию задач между самостоятельными серверами.
Безопасность от перенагрузок и DDoS-атак
Система доставки контента гарантирует безопасность веб-ресурсов от рассредоточенных вторжений типа отказ в обслуживании. Географическое распределение машин обеспечивает поглощать большие объёмы опасного объёма без влияния на функционирование. Атакующие обращения распределяются между множеством серверов вместо сосредоточения на одном сервере.
Фильтрация трафика на этапе пограничных машин останавливает странные вызовы до попадания основного узла. Платформы оценивают шаблоны активности и определяют аномальную деятельность. Алгоритмы машинного обучения идентифицируют характеристики роботизированных нападений и ботнетов. Отсечение злонамеренных IP-адресов выполняется самостоятельно.
Контроль скорости обращений пин ап казино исключает перегрузку от одного отправителя. Механизм rate limiting устанавливает предельное объём запросов с адреса за промежуток. Превышение ограничения вызывает к промежуточной отсечению источника.
Запасная ёмкость распространённой системы позволяет обрабатывать с внезапными пиками законного объёма. Масштабируемость сети гарантирует выполнение увеличенного количества вызовов без падения эффективности. Самостоятельное переназначение загрузки компенсирует выход конкретных узлов при нападениях.
Преимущества и ограничения CDN
Применение сети распространения материалов предоставляет обилие достоинств для хозяев веб-ресурсов. Методика устраняет ключевые вопросы быстродействия пин ап и работоспособности.
- Ускорение подгрузки веб-страниц наращивает удовлетворённость юзеров и улучшает поведенческие показатели. Уменьшение периода реакции позитивно влияет на продажи и торговые показатели.
- Снижение нагруженности на центральный сервер экономит процессорные возможности и расходы на инфраструктуру. Улучшение пропускной способности канала сокращает затраты на объём.
- Повышение отказоустойчивости обеспечивает работоспособность веб-ресурса при неполадках единичных узлов. Географическое резервирование ограждает от локальных технических проблем.
- Безопасность от DDoS-атак предотвращает недоступность портала при вредоносных операциях. Распространённая система поглощает опасный поток без воздействия на законных посетителей.
Недостатки системы требуют анализа при планировании внедрения. Расценки предложений операторов может быть значительной для проектов с большими количествами потока. Настройка сохранения изменяемого содержимого требует усилий специалистов. Зависимость от стороннего поставщика порождает риски при программных проблемах.
Где задействуются сети распространения содержимого
Системы распространения содержимого находят задействование в разных областях онлайн индустрии. Система сделалась эталоном для компаний, функционирующих с огромными объёмами потока.
Системы потокового видео задействуют CDN для передачи материалов миллионам аудитории синхронно. Системы онлайн-кинотеатров гарантируют проигрывание роликов без задержек. Распределённая система справляется с максимальными загрузками во время релизов известных кинолент.
Интернет-магазины применяют CDN для разгона загрузки списков изделий и картинок продукции. Скоростная отдача контента существенна для конверсии клиентов в клиентов. Задержки при изучении предметов ведут к сокращению покупок.
Новостные ресурсы применяют рассредоточенную инфраструктуру для обработки пиков трафика при выпуске резонансных публикаций. Система гарантирует доступность портала при внезапном росте объёма аудитории. Картинки и видеоматериалы загружаются стремительно независимо от географического расположения зрителей.
Игровые системы доставляют апдейты через CDN миллионам пользователей. Рассредоточение данных инсталляции pin up выполняется эффективнее через географически близлежащие узлы. Деловые ресурсы и обучающие платформы используют методику для международного покрытия.
